Enviar ficheros comprimidos con netcat

13 03 2008

Enviar un fichero entre dos máquinas:

$ netcat -l -p 5555 > salida.txt
$ netcat remote.host 5555 -q 0 < entrada.txt

Enviar un fichero comprimido entre dos máquinas:

$ nc -l -p 5555 | gunzip > salida.txt
$ cat entrada.txt | gzip | nc remote.host 5555 -q 0

Enviar un directorio comprimido entre dos máquinas:

$ netcat -l -p 3333 -v > backup.tgz
$ tar -czvpf - /path/to/files | netcat -q 0 remote.host 3333

Información original


Acciones

Información

Deja un comentario